What is DevExpress.Printing.v14.1.Core.dll?

DLL (Dynamic Link Library) files like DevExpress.Printing.v14.1.Core.dll are important components of computer software. They contain code and data that multiple programs can use, which helps to save disk space and avoid duplication of code. In the case of DevExpress.Printing.v14.1.Core.dll, it specifically provides printing functionality for software that uses the DevExpress framework, such as Open Freely.

When Open Freely needs to print documents or images, it can call on the code and resources stored in DevExpress.Printing.v14.1.Core.dll to execute the printing tasks. This allows Open Freely to focus on its core functions while relying on the DLL file to handle printing-related processes. Therefore, DevExpress.Printing.v14.1.Core.dll plays a crucial role in enabling Open Freely to provide seamless printing capabilities to its users.

DLL files often play a critical role in system operations. Despite their importance, these files can sometimes source system errors. Below we consider some of the most frequently encountered faults associated with DLL files.

  • DevExpress.Printing.v14.1.Core.dll could not be loaded: This error suggests that the system was unable to load the DLL file into memory. This could happen due to file corruption, incompatibility, or because the file is missing or incorrectly installed.
  • Cannot register DevExpress.Printing.v14.1.Core.dll: The message means that the operating system failed to register the DLL file. This can happen if there are file permission issues, if the DLL file is missing or misplaced, or if there's an issue with the Registry.
  • DevExpress.Printing.v14.1.Core.dll Access Violation: This points to a situation where a process has attempted to interact with DevExpress.Printing.v14.1.Core.dll in a way that violates system or application rules. This might be due to incorrect programming, memory overflows, or the running process lacking necessary permissions.
  • This application failed to start because DevExpress.Printing.v14.1.Core.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error occurs when an application tries to access a DLL file that doesn't exist in the system. Reinstalling the application can restore the missing DLL file if it was included in the original software package.
  • DevExpress.Printing.v14.1.Core.dll not found: This indicates that the application you're trying to run is looking for a specific DLL file that it can't locate. This could be due to the DLL file being missing, corrupted, or incorrectly installed.

Step 1: Open the Command Prompt

Step 1: Open the Command Prompt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Command Prompt in the search bar and press Enter.

  3.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.

Step 2: Run Check Disk Utility

Step 2: Run Check Disk Utility Thumbnail
  1. In the Command Prompt window, type chkdsk /f and press Enter.

  2. If the system reports that it cannot run the check because the disk is in use, type Y and press Enter to schedule the check for the next system restart.

Step 3: Restart Your Computer

Step 3: Restart Your Computer Thumbnail
  1. If you had to schedule the check, restart your computer for the check to be performed.
